Will Thule racks work?
Posted: Sun Jun 03, 2007 6:43 am
by Artacoma
Don't know about Thule but Yakima racks work, you need the extended leg and it gives an inch or two clearance from the bars to the roof.

by DavePhotos
Thule makes a high mount gutter rack as well they actually have two versions... the model 387 has 20 cm's of clearance from the gutter to the bar and the model 953 has 27 cm's of clearance. Not sure how much clearance the high roof needs but I am sure one of these will work...
